[PATCH] For git-subtree, when installing docs (make install-doc), create man1 folder first.

I installed Git subtree and discovered that the if the man1dir doesn't exist the man-page for Git Subtree is just called man1.

So, small patch to create the folder first in the Makefile. Hope everything is right with the patch and submitting of the patch.

 contrib/subtree/Makefile | 1 +
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+)
diff --git a/contrib/subtree/Makefile b/contrib/subtree/Makefile
index 05cdd5c..a341cf4 100644
--- a/contrib/subtree/Makefile
+++ b/contrib/subtree/Makefile
@@ -35,6 +35,7 @@ install: $(GIT_SUBTREE)
 install-doc: install-man
 
 install-man: $(GIT_SUBTREE_DOC)
+	mkdir -p $(man1dir)
 	$(INSTALL) -m 644 $^ $(man1dir)
 
 $(GIT_SUBTREE_DOC): $(GIT_SUBTREE_XML)
